Are there any part-time or online MIM programs available in the UK for working professionals?

For working professionals interested in pursuing a Master in Management (MiM) in the UK, there are several flexible options available that accommodate the demands of continued employment. Many prestigious universities have tailored their programs to be more accessible to those who cannot commit to full-time on-campus education. 

For instance, the University of London's online Global Master of Management allows you to study from anywhere in the world, providing a curriculum that matches their on-campus quality. Warwick Business School offers a modular approach in their part-time MiM program, which includes online learning combined with intensive face-to-face workshops in London. This hybrid model is designed to give students the flexibility they need without compromising on the immersive business education experience. 

Imperial College Business School also provides a part-time program designed to be completed alongside a full-time job. Their teaching schedule is highly accommodating, with courses offered in the evenings or on weekends. Additionally, these programs often incorporate real-world projects and live online classes, facilitating practical learning and interaction with industry experts and peers globally. 

When choosing a program, it’s crucial to consider the accreditation, curriculum, flexibility, and networking opportunities. Accreditation from bodies such as AMBA, EQUIS, or AACSB is indicative of a quality program. Also, look for courses that offer practical learning opportunities, as they can enhance your understanding and applicability of management theories in your current job. 

These flexible learning paths not only advance your educational qualifications but also enrich your professional experience by integrating learning with your ongoing work commitments.
